This CURT Class 3 Trailer Hitch is designed for serious towing, offering a vehicle-specific fit and robust weight capacity. It features a 2-inch receiver tube and is tested to SAE J684 standards for safety. The hitch is constructed from high-strength steel with precision welding and protected by a dual-coat finish for superior resistance to rust, chipping, and UV damage.

Pasos xerais da instalación

  1. Inspect Vehicle Frame: Ensure the vehicle's frame is in suitable condition for installation, free from damage or excessive corrosion.
  2. Eliminar obstáculos: Temporarily remove any components that obstruct the installation area, such as exhaust hangers or bumper fascia, as indicated in your specific instruction sheet.
  3. Clean Weldnuts (if applicable): If your vehicle's frame has weld nuts that are corroded, clean them using a wire brush and penetrating lubricant. For extreme cases, a thread tap matching the hardware size may be necessary.

    Video: This video demonstrates techniques for cleaning weld nuts on a vehicle frame, which may be necessary before installing a trailer hitch.

  4. Colocar o enganche: Carefully raise the hitch into position against the vehicle's frame. Use jack stands or a second person to help hold the hitch in place. Ensure the hitch is level and all attachment points align.
  5. Fishwiring Hardware (if applicable): For attachment points within enclosed frame sections, use the provided fish wire to guide bolts and spacer plates into position.

    Video: This video illustrates the fishwiring technique for installing hardware in enclosed frame sections, a common method for hitch installation.

  6. Drill Attachment Holes (if required): If your specific installation requires drilling new holes, use the hitch as a template to mark the locations. Drill a pilot hole, then gradually enlarge it to the required size using a cobalt drill bit with coolant.

    Video: This video demonstrates the technique for drilling new attachment holes in the vehicle frame, if necessary for hitch installation.

  7. Asegurar o enganche: Attach the hitch to the vehicle frame using the provided hardware. Hand-tighten all bolts initially.
  8. Torque All Fasteners: Once all bolts are in place and hand-tightened, use a torque wrench to tighten them to the exact torque specifications provided in your instruction sheet. It is crucial to follow these specifications to ensure a secure and safe installation.
  9. Reinstall Removed Parts: Reattach any exhaust components, bumper fascia, or other parts that were temporarily removed during installation.

Especificacións

CaracterísticaEspecificación
MarcaCURT
Modelo13333
Peso do elemento13 libras
Dimensións do produto11.3 x 8.9 x 7 polgadas
MaterialAceiro carbono
Tipo de acabadoREVESTIMENTO EN PO NEGRO BRILLANTE
Tamaño do receptor2 polgadas
Peso bruto do remolque (MTW)6,000 libras.
Peso da lingua (TW)600 libras.
Distribución de peso (WD)10,000 libras.
Distribución do peso Peso da lingua (WDTW)1,000 libras.
